    Teacher Stuff. The name says it all. This is a true, oldie-but-goodie place I've personally been…read morerelying on since I started teaching back in '99. If I'm looking for classroom essentials, this is the ideal solution since it's a short drive to get to from work. There's a nice inventory of books, pens, pencils, arts & crafts, card stock, sentence strips, class charts (by appropriate grade) and so many other class items. As far as pricing goes, you won't find ultra-low prices. There are however, a few sale items off to one side by the register that vary from time to time- but these items aren't the hot commodity ones like reading books or learning hands-on materials for elementary grades. They're more like playdough, crayons, etc for younger grades. Still, if you're an educator, tax is exempted. Service is fine for me though. If you by chance can't seem to find something, the ladies help out.

    As a Preschool teacher I am always looking for the best places to refresh my classroom, especially…read moreat the beginning of the school year. Does Teacher's Stuff have everything that Lakeshore would? Not on hand, this is a small store. They will always order anything you need though. But for what they lack in space they make up for in customer service. I have never had a negative experience with prices (about average for NYC). The store is tucked away, always has street parking and never long lines. It's a bit far without a car unless you're in the area, but I try to get there a few times a year.
